The Complex Connection Between Migraines and Ear Pain
Migraines are notorious for causing intense headaches, but their effects often extend beyond just head pain. One lesser-known symptom that many people experience during a migraine attack is ear pain. This discomfort can range from mild aching to sharp, stabbing sensations inside or around the ear. Understanding why this happens requires a deeper dive into the anatomy and physiology of migraines.
Migraines are neurological events that involve abnormal brain activity affecting blood flow and nerve signaling. The trigeminal nerve, one of the largest cranial nerves, plays a pivotal role here. It supplies sensation to much of the face and head, including areas around the ear. When this nerve becomes activated or irritated during a migraine, it can cause referred pain — meaning the brain perceives pain in areas connected to but not directly affected by the original issue.
Ear pain during migraines is often accompanied by other symptoms such as sensitivity to sound (phonophobia), dizziness, or even ringing in the ears (tinnitus). These signs suggest that migraines influence not just vascular structures but also sensory pathways related to hearing and balance.
How Migraines Trigger Ear Pain: The Role of Nerves
The trigeminal nerve branches extensively across the face and head. One branch innervates parts of the ear canal and external ear. When migraine activity stimulates this nerve, it can send pain signals perceived as originating in or near the ear.
Additionally, the vestibulocochlear nerve (cranial nerve VIII), responsible for hearing and balance, can be indirectly affected during migraine episodes. This influence may explain why some migraine sufferers report symptoms like ear fullness or vertigo alongside ear pain.
Another factor involves inflammation around blood vessels supplying these nerves. Migraines cause neurogenic inflammation—chemical changes that sensitize nerves and heighten pain perception. This process contributes to discomfort radiating into regions like the ears.

Differentiating Migraine Ear Pain From Other Causes
Ear pain has numerous potential origins—middle ear infections, TMJ disorders, sinus infections, dental issues, or even neuralgias like glossopharyngeal neuralgia. Differentiating migraine-induced ear pain involves careful assessment of symptom patterns and triggers:
- Migraine-related ear pain typically coincides with headache attacks and resolves as migraines subside.
- Infections usually present with fever, localized redness/swelling, and persistent worsening without headache predominance.
- TMJ disorders cause jaw clicking/popping along with localized tenderness near the jaw joint rather than generalized head pain.
- Neuralgias produce sharp electric shock-like pains rather than dull aching associated with migraines.
A detailed clinical history combined with physical examination helps clinicians pinpoint whether a migraine is behind your ear discomfort.
The Science Behind Migraines Causing Ear Pain
Migraines involve complex interactions between vascular changes, neuronal excitability, and inflammatory processes within the brainstem and cranial nerves. Several scientific insights shed light on how these mechanisms translate into ear symptoms:
The Trigeminal Vascular System’s Role
The trigeminovascular system consists of trigeminal nerves innervating cerebral blood vessels. During a migraine attack:
- Cerebral blood vessels dilate abnormally.
- The trigeminal nerve releases neuropeptides like calcitonin gene-related peptide (CGRP).
- This release causes inflammation and sensitization of surrounding tissues.
Because branches of this system reach areas near the ears, inflammation can spread to adjacent sensory nerves serving the external auditory canal and middle ear structures.
Nerve Cross-Talk: Referred Pain Mechanism
Referred pain occurs when sensory nerves share common pathways in the spinal cord or brainstem. The trigeminal nerve shares connections with cervical spinal nerves that also supply parts of the neck and ears. This overlap allows irritation in one area (like blood vessels around the brain) to be misinterpreted by the brain as originating from another region (the ears).
Migraine-Induced Vestibular Dysfunction
Vestibular migraines represent a subtype where balance organs are affected alongside headache symptoms. Dysfunction within vestibular pathways explains why some patients experience vertigo coupled with ear pressure or discomfort during migraines.
Treatment Strategies for Migraine-Related Ear Pain
Addressing ear pain caused by migraines requires targeting both underlying migraine attacks and symptomatic relief for ear discomfort.
Migraine-Specific Therapies
Effective migraine management reduces frequency and severity of attacks—and thus associated symptoms like ear pain:
- Avoid triggers: Common culprits include stress, certain foods (e.g., aged cheese), dehydration, irregular sleep patterns.
- Medications: Triptans (sumatriptan), NSAIDs (ibuprofen), anti-nausea drugs help abort acute attacks.
- Preventive drugs: Beta-blockers (propranolol), anticonvulsants (topiramate), CGRP antagonists reduce attack frequency over time.
- Lifestyle modifications: Regular exercise, balanced diet, adequate hydration improve overall control.
Treating Ear Symptoms Specifically
While managing migraines remains paramount, certain measures help ease ear discomfort:
- Pain relievers: Over-the-counter analgesics may reduce mild aching sensations in ears during attacks.
- Ear protection: Avoid loud noises which exacerbate phonophobia and tinnitus linked to migraines.
- Cognitive-behavioral approaches: Stress reduction techniques lessen central nervous system sensitization contributing to heightened pain perception around ears.
Consultation with healthcare professionals ensures personalized treatment plans tailored toward both headaches and accompanying otologic symptoms.

The Importance Of Proper Diagnosis For Can A Migraine Cause Ear Pain?
Pinpointing whether your ear pain stems from migraines is critical because treatments differ vastly between causes. Misdiagnosis may lead to unnecessary antibiotics or dental procedures while neglecting effective migraine therapies.
Healthcare providers rely on detailed histories focusing on timing relative to headaches, symptom clusters including nausea/photophobia/phonophobia, response to migraine medications, plus ruling out infections via otoscopic exams or imaging if needed.
Neurologists specializing in headaches often coordinate care alongside ENT specialists when symptoms overlap between neurological and otologic domains.
